ItemAdding e ItemAdded

04/06/2008 - 01:20 por Jorge | Informe spam
Hola a todos

Tengo el siguiente problema, estoy creando una serie de eventhandler para
obtener cierta informacion y con esta informacion generar ciertos procesos
sobre algunas librerias de mi sitio sharepoint.
Cuando se ejecutan los eventos add sobre la libreria de documentos sobre la
cual estoy trabajando necesito leer la metadata del documento que estoy
ingresando, esto por que: por que a la libreria de sharepoint le tengo que
agregar una columna de tipo numerico que manejare como identificador de los
documentos. Lo que sucede es que no puedo leer el valor que viene cuando se
crea un nuevo documento y el usuario ingresa un valor en esta columna.
He probado con AfterProperties y beforeProperties pero siempre me muestra un
valor nulo.
Alguien sabe como puedo leer este valor en el ItemAdding y en el ItemAdded.
Muchas gracias por su colaboracion.

Preguntas similare

Leer las respuestas

#1 Wenceslao Leon
10/06/2008 - 23:33 | Informe spam
Hola Jorge,

en el Itemadding e ItemAdded la metadata viene vacia, luego de agregarse el
item a la lista, se genera un evento updated del item,
ahi podrias recuperar los valores.


"Elecktrus" wrote in message
news:
Hola, Jorge:
Lo que ocurre es que dependiendo de que evento, lo que viene relleno es
uno
u otro. Creo recordar que en el Itemadding viene relleno el after, y en el
itemadded es el before (lo digo de cabeza, asi que igual es al reves).
Al añadir, hay campos, como el ID (o los calculados) que no existen y
vendran nulos.
Si te da lo mismo, en el itemAdded ya dispones del valor ID, y con el
puedes
acceder a la biblioteca y recuperar de alli los valores, que eso siempre
funciona.

Si la respuesta te es util pulsa el boton YES. Ayudanos a mantener el foro
al día.


"Jorge" wrote:

Hola a todos

Tengo el siguiente problema, estoy creando una serie de eventhandler para
obtener cierta informacion y con esta informacion generar ciertos
procesos
sobre algunas librerias de mi sitio sharepoint.
Cuando se ejecutan los eventos add sobre la libreria de documentos sobre
la
cual estoy trabajando necesito leer la metadata del documento que estoy
ingresando, esto por que: por que a la libreria de sharepoint le tengo
que
agregar una columna de tipo numerico que manejare como identificador de
los
documentos. Lo que sucede es que no puedo leer el valor que viene cuando
se
crea un nuevo documento y el usuario ingresa un valor en esta columna.
He probado con AfterProperties y beforeProperties pero siempre me muestra
un
valor nulo.
Alguien sabe como puedo leer este valor en el ItemAdding y en el
ItemAdded.
Muchas gracias por su colaboracion.
email Siga el debate Respuesta Responder a este mensaje
Ads by Google
Help Hacer una preguntaRespuesta Tengo una respuesta
Search Busqueda sugerida